Did Kim Soo Hyun use fake chat accounts to talk to Kim Sae Ron? GaroSero hits back with new photos and FaceTime records
Kim Soo Hyun denies dating Kim Sae Ron as a minor, but GaroSero drops alleged chats and photos. Kim Se Ui claims he used multiple accounts to hide evidence.

Kim Soo Hyun continues to face public scrutiny as GaroSero releases new evidence despite the actor’s firm denial that he dated Kim Sae Ron when she was a minor. On Thursday, Kim Soo Hyun’s legal team responded to five images released earlier by the YouTube channel, which alleged that he had been in a relationship with the late actor when she was underage. His team refuted the claims, stating that the pictures were from a time when they were dating as adults. However, just hours after those denials, GaroSero hit back with another set of alleged evidence. In a live broadcast on April 2, Kim Se Ui, a member of the YouTube channel, released new alleged chat logs between Kim Soo Hyun and Kim Sae Ron.
Kim Se Ui revealed screenshots of alleged KakaoTalk messages between the two actors. One particular message, dated April 13, 2018, showed Sae Ron expressing frustration over their lack of communication. At 2:30 AM KST, she wrote, “Oppa, when you miss me and need me, you keep in touch with me without a problem, but when I need you, you’re always MIA. It bothers me that I can’t get in contact with you, and it’s inconvenient. If you don’t put in the effort, then I’m not seeing you anymore.” To prove his point, Kim Se Ui argued that this was not the kind of message casual acquaintances or colleagues would send to each other. He claimed it showed an emotional attachment—possibly a romantic one. (The reports and recordings mentioned in this article could not be independently verified by SCREEN.)

Did Kim Soo Hyun use multiple accounts to hide his chats?
Kim Se Ui then went on to make some wild claims about Kim Soo Hyun allegedly using multiple KakaoTalk accounts under different names to erase evidence of his chats with Kim Sae Ron. He speculated that the Dream High star created a new account to talk to Kim Sae Ron, exchanged messages for a while, deleted the account to erase traces and then repeated the process with a new account. One of the leaked screenshots allegedly shows Kim Soo Hyun’s name appearing as “unknown”, which, according to Kim Se Ui, supports the claim that he was trying to hide his conversations.
April 13, 2018: Kim Soo Hyun greeted Kim Sae Ron with her nickname “Pretty Nero, are you doing well?” In another chat from May 16, 2018, Kim Sae Ron jokingly warned him about not replying on time: “The day after tomorrow sounds good, but if I don’t hear from you tomorrow like I didn’t today, you’re dead.” Kim Soo Hyun responded with: “Was I… MIA again?”
One of the most debated alleged evidence is a photo of Kim Soo Hyun kissing Kim Sae Ron on the cheek. Kim Soo Hyun’s team claimed that the image was taken in 2019, when Kim Sae Ron was 20 years old. However, Kim Se Ui argued otherwise, claiming that Kim Sae Ron had previously mentioned that the picture was from 2016, when she was still a minor. Sarcastically questioning the age discrepancy, he stated: “Did she suddenly become a college student overnight? What major was she studying back then?”
Kim Se Ui also claimed to have records of Kim Sae Ron calling and FaceTiming Kim Soo Hyun multiple times in 2018, when she was still 17 years old. Warning beforehand, the YouTuber claimed to have five of Kim Sae Ron’s mobile phones, four of her laptops, and support from Korea’s top digital forensic experts. Kim Soo Hyun’s team has yet to provide a detailed rebuttal to the latest allegations. So far, the actor has denied any wrongdoing, but as Garosero promises to reveal more forensic-backed evidence, pressure is mounting.
